Is Tesco The Xmas Winner ?

Tesco (TSCO) enjoyed a strong Xmas and perhaps surprised many of the pundits, not to to say the opposition, with all round growth as sales rose both at home and abroad. Like for like group sales for the 6 weeks to 9th January rose by 2.1%, even UK like for like sales were up 1.3% and […]
